What is Wind Mitigation Report

The Florida Wind Mitigation Inspection Report is an inspection document used by qualified inspectors to assess a property's wind damage resistance, ensuring compliance with Florida Building Code standards.

What is the Florida Wind Mitigation Inspection Report?

The Florida Wind Mitigation Inspection Report serves a crucial role in assessing a property's safety against wind damage, particularly in hurricane-prone areas. This report is defined within the framework of the Florida Building Code (FBC) and is essential for homeowners seeking to ensure their properties meet wind resistance standards. Conducting a thorough wind resistance assessment according to the FBC can potentially mitigate significant damage during extreme weather events.

Purpose and Benefits of the Florida Wind Mitigation Inspection Report

Obtaining a wind mitigation report offers several advantages, particularly regarding potential savings on insurance premiums. Insurers often provide discounts to homeowners who can demonstrate compliant wind-resistant features. These reports also help homeowners maintain compliance with safety standards, providing peace of mind in ensuring their properties are secure against natural disasters.

Key Features of the Florida Wind Mitigation Inspection Report

  • Roof covering assessment
  • Roof deck attachment evaluation
  • Windborne debris protection analysis
  • Roof to wall connection details
  • Roof geometry examination
The inspections conducted by qualified inspectors are detail-oriented, ensuring that every necessary aspect of the property’s wind resistance is thoroughly reviewed. This comprehensive analysis results in an accurate property wind resistance assessment.
